Job Summary
The Accounts Payable Specialist is responsible for all accounts payable transactions, reports, and check runs. The Accounts Payable Specialist will maintain all accounts payable files and provide backup for payroll and cashiering. Accurately and in a timely manner sorts all A/P invoices and statements and verify proper written approval. Verifies invoices against purchase order for price, sales tax, discount, and sum total. Ensures that all W-9’s are received from all Vendors. Communicate with Vendors as needed to resolve issues. Verifies proper coding and selection of payment schedule and ensures proper trade discount. Inputs invoices and check requests, resolves variances, and prepares check runs. Runs month end reports for A/P and Accrued Purchases reconciliation and process the AP month-end close. Maintain and save electronic AP invoices and Payments with related reports. Prepare and file 1099’s at year-end. Provide backup for cashiering as needed. Collects daily receipts, completes bank deposit, and cashiering reports.
